Colleagues’ Intervention Fails as Opeyemi Aiyeola Snubs Jamiu Azeez’s Apology

141

Nollywood actress Opeyemi Aiyeola has continued to keep her distance from her godson, Jamiu Azeez, despite his recent public apology and reported interventions by some of her colleagues, indicating that the rift between them is far from over.

Azeez had earlier issued a heartfelt apology on social media, admitting that he had acted childishly and acknowledging the deep emotional hurt he caused the actress.

Although he refrained from stating exactly what went wrong between them, he stressed that Opeyemi’s name remained an indelible part of his life story and appealed for forgiveness.

However, the apology appears not to have had the desired effect.

Sources close to the situation revealed that a few of Aiyeola’s colleagues within the industry had reportedly reached out to plead on Azeez’s behalf, urging her to soften her stance.

Despite these efforts, the interventions were said to be insufficient to quench the hurt or change the actress’s position.

Rather than directly addressing the apology or the pleas, Aiyeola took to her Instagram page on Friday to share a video of herself, where she highlighted two of her personal life rules—an action many have interpreted as a subtle response to the ongoing situation.

In the video, the actress spoke firmly about emotional strength and self-control, warning against allowing emotions to become a burden or giving others the satisfaction of seeing one broken.

“You see rules no 4 & 6,” she wrote. “Never let emotions weigh you down. Never let them see you finish. Please write them boldly in capitals for your own good.”

Many observers believe the tone and timing of the post are a clear pointer to why the problem between Aiyeola and Azeez remains unresolved.

Her emphasis on emotional boundaries suggests that the wounds run deeper than a public apology or third-party mediation can easily fix.
